GMC Sonoma owners have reported 71 engine and engine cooling related problems since 1996. Table 1 shows the 24 most common engine and engine cooling problems. The number one most common problem is related to the vehicle's engine cooling system (9 problems). The second most common problem is related to the vehicle's gasoline engine (7 problems).
